
PureCode AI
打开网站-
工具介绍:以你的代码库为上下文深度理解的UI开发副驾,覆盖从需求到实现规划,自动生成组件、理解代码,整体交付提速50%。
-
收录时间:2025-10-28
-
社交媒体&邮箱:
工具信息
什么是 PureCode AI
PureCode AI 是一款面向前端与全栈团队的智能开发助手,专注于以现有代码库为上下文,自动生成并组装界面组件,理解项目结构,规划实现路径,从而把 UI 交付周期显著缩短。它通过解析仓库中的路由、样式、状态管理、接口约定与命名规范,在不打破既有架构的前提下产出可落地的组件与页面骨架,并给出清晰的改动清单与开发步骤,减少重复性样板代码与手工对齐工作。开发者只需以自然语言描述需求或选定目标文件,便可获得与项目风格一致的实现建议、复用提示与差异对比,配合团队评审即可安全合入。借助这种上下文感知的能力,PureCode AI 旨在将 UI 开发速度提升约一倍,同时提高代码一致性与可维护性,帮助团队在多人协作中保持设计系统与组件库的统一。此外,它还能把需求拆解为任务列表,标注依赖关系与接口对接点,给出分工建议与优先级,便于管理者掌控进度。对于大型或历史项目,PureCode AI 能快速梳理关键模块的调用关系,提示可抽象的通用能力与冗余实现,辅助团队逐步完成重构与演进。在保持开发者主导的前提下,工具提供可审阅、可回滚的增量改动,使自动化与人工判断形成可靠的闭环。
PureCode AI主要功能
- 上下文感知的组件生成:基于项目代码库、样式体系与命名规范,生成与现有工程风格一致的界面组件与页面骨架,减少手写样板代码。
- 代码库理解与依赖梳理:分析模块结构与调用关系,定位可复用片段与公共能力,帮助识别重复实现与潜在抽象点。
- 实现规划与任务拆解:根据需求描述输出分步实现方案、文件改动清单、接口对接点与优先级,便于团队协作与进度跟踪。
- 与设计系统对齐:遵循现有设计变量、主题与组件规范,降低 UI 偏差,维护跨页面的一致性。
- 变更预览与差异对比:在应用改动前给出候选代码与差异视图,便于评审、修改与回滚,提升变更可控性。
- 复用与重构建议:提示可以抽离为通用组件的逻辑,给出更清晰的结构化实现思路,助力渐进式优化。
- 需求到代码的闭环:从自然语言需求到落地实现,形成可追溯的链路,提升沟通效率与交付确定性。
PureCode AI适用人群
适合希望提升界面交付效率与一致性的团队与个人,包括前端工程师、全栈开发者、设计系统与组件库维护者、技术负责人、项目经理,以及需要快速验证界面原型的初创团队或外包团队。在复杂遗留项目、多人协作与频繁改版场景下尤为受益。
PureCode AI使用步骤
- 连接项目代码库,授权工具读取必要的源代码与配置文件,用于建立上下文。
- 等待完成索引与分析,工具会梳理模块结构、样式体系与依赖关系。
- 通过自然语言描述界面需求,或选择目标页面/组件作为生成与改造的起点。
- 查看自动生成的实现规划与文件改动清单,确认约束与命名规范。
- 预览候选组件与代码片段,按需微调属性、样式与交互逻辑。
- 在独立分支应用增量变更,结合本地运行进行自测与迭代修改。
- 发起代码评审,处理意见后合入主干,并记录变更说明以便追溯。
PureCode AI行业案例
电商团队利用该工具批量搭建营销页与活动页的通用模块,实现主题与样式统一,改版周期由周缩短至天级。企业级 SaaS 团队在构建数据看板与表单场景时,通过实现规划快速识别复用点,减少重复组件开发。教育平台在迭代题目编辑与批阅界面时,依托代码库分析统一交互与状态管理,降低新成员上手成本。金融内部系统在复杂表格与审批流程页面中,借助增量改造策略稳步完成遗留界面重构。
PureCode AI收费模式
该类智能开发工具通常采用订阅制,可能按团队规模、功能级别或使用量计费,具体方案与是否提供免费试用以官网公布为准。建议在评估期内先以小范围项目验证效果,再根据协作规模选择合适套餐。
PureCode AI优点和缺点
优点:
- 以代码库为上下文生成组件,风格与架构更贴合现有工程。
- 从需求到实现形成闭环,缩短 UI 开发与评审周期。
- 帮助识别复用与重构机会,提升代码一致性与可维护性。
- 增量变更与差异对比降低风险,便于团队协作与回滚。
- 减少样板代码与手动对齐工作,释放开发者时间聚焦业务逻辑。
缺点:
- 首次索引大型仓库可能耗时,短期内难以立刻覆盖全部场景。
- 对复杂业务语义与隐性约定的理解仍需开发者把关与校正。
- 生成质量依赖于项目规范度与上下文完整性,非标准化项目效果受限。
- 需要建立清晰的评审流程与分支策略,避免误用导致不必要变更。
- 在极端定制化界面与交互中,自动生成的收益相对有限。
PureCode AI热门问题
-
是否需要完整接入整个仓库才能使用?
建议提供尽可能完整的代码上下文(含样式、路由与配置),以便获得更贴合项目的生成结果;也可从子模块试用并逐步扩展。
-
会直接覆盖现有代码吗?
以增量变更为主,先给出差异与候选改动,通常在独立分支进行评审与合并,避免直接覆盖。
-
如何保证与设计系统和组件规范的一致性?
工具会参考仓库中的设计变量、主题与命名约定生成代码;建议在项目中明确规范文件与示例以提升一致性。
-
对新项目和遗留项目哪个更合适?
两者均适用:新项目可快速搭建基础组件与页面骨架;遗留项目可借助依赖梳理与复用建议逐步重构。
-
如何提升生成结果的可用性?
提供清晰的需求描述、约束条件与示例代码,保持统一的样式与命名规范,并通过小步迭代持续校正。



